First-half Ward winner sends Holbeach United in UCL Cup semi-finals

Holbeach United 1
Boston Town 0

A first-half goal from Chris Ward fired Holbeach United to a ChromaSport UCL Knockout Cup quarter-final win over rivals Boston Town on Wednesday night.

Ward produced a fine finish from an Andrew Tidswell corner on the half-hour to settle a close Carter’s Park contest – and book a semi-final date with Wisbech Town.

Ryan Parnell hit the post late on for Boston, but Tom Roberts’ side were just about value for the victory in front of a crowd of 121.

Holbeach, who host Cogenhoe United on Saturday, will take on Wisbech in the last four next Wednesday night.
